Trivia about the song I’m the Girl by Sarah Vaughan

On which albums was the song “I’m the Girl” released by Sarah Vaughan?
Sarah Vaughan released the song on the albums “Sassy” in 1956, “The Complete Sarah Vaughan on Mercury Vol. 1 - Great Jazz Years 1954-1956” in 1987, and “Milestones of a Jazz Legend - Sarah Vaughan, Vol. 3 (1954-1956)” in 2018.
Who composed the song “I’m the Girl” by Sarah Vaughan?
The song “I’m the Girl” by Sarah Vaughan was composed by James Shelton.
